159 Mistakes Couples Make In The Bedroom: And How To Avoid Them [Print Replica] Kindle Edition
159 MISTAKES COUPLES MAKE IN THE BEDROOM
Fifty percent of couples are dissatisfied with their sex life. How do you keep the passion in a long-term relationship? This book is about common sex issues a couple may have, it gives advice and it offers solutions. Written by a doctor of clinical psychology with extensive knowledge about relationships and sex, this book is not only for couples but for everyone who wants to have a great relationship and a fulfilling love life and for health practitioners who want to know the most common issues couples bring to therapy.
This book is about love and sex, myths and taboos, dysfunctions, problems and mistakes that people bring to therapy and how to avoid them. It is a self-help guide backed by current research to help people of all ages, from very young to old age, create healthy relationships and to achieve self-actualization.
ABOUT THE AUTHOR
Dr. Bea M. Jaffrey is an American-trained clinical psychologist and psychotherapist in Geneva, Switzerland. In her private practice, she counsels couples, families and individuals. She feels passionate about helping people creating the fulfilling relationships that they desire. Using a warm, interactive and practical approach, she has assisted hundreds of couples to form a closer connection, to revitalize their sexual life and to improve their communication skills. Dr. Jaffrey believes that everyone is capable of having a great sex life regardless of how long they have been married (or in a committed relationship). "We need to be proactive and educate ourselves to create happy families," she says.
Dr. Bea Jaffrey is also a wife and a mother of six children and six Chihuahuas. She is a member of the American Psychological Association (APA) and several Swiss associations.

Reviewed in the United States on January 15, 2018
Please do not treat this book as a bible, but read other books and perspectives as well. Many things the author calls a mistake your partner may actually enjoy. Every person and couple is unique, and you have to find what works best for you and your significant other. The author writes with all the authority of an expert and the book sort've has a feel as if it's the bible of sex, and that every word is infallible, but please do not treat it as such. This book is written by a female author and gives great insights into what works well for women in the bedroom, but it looks very negatively upon things that males enjoy and labels many of them simply as mistakes, whereas some of these things (such as doggy style or anal) might be touted as great pleasures (for men and women) from a different book or source.
Have you ever seen websites with titles like "the 15 worst foods for your waistline"? Where the foods listed were thought to be healthy a few years ago, or are described as healthy currently by someone of a different opinion? This book kind've reminds me of those lists, except the book is a list of sexual advice, not dieting advice. It should be taken with a grain of salt and a realization that the author is writing from a certain perspective, even though she is calling herself an expert and treating her words like she is writing the bible of sex. That being said, there are some very good sections, that are not written from a one-sided perspective, and are clear mistakes. For example, mistakes like sex addiction, or cybersex addition, or loss of desire, are serious and important issues, and the advice here is more helpful than some of the advice on say doggy style, or sex on a washing machine, or sex in an elevator, blah blah blah.
